Arcata Receives US SBA Region IX Prime Contractor of the Year Award

Arcata Associates, Inc. was named the 2006 Region IX Prime Contractor of the Year by the US Small Business Administration. The announcement was made on February 22, 2006.

This annual award honors small businesses that have provided the government and industry with outstanding goods and services as prime contractors. Only federal agencies may nominate a small business for the award. Kevin Petersen, NASA Dryden Flight Research Center (DFRC) Director; Robert Medina, NASA DFRC Small Business Specialist; Don Shehane, NASA DFRC Research Facilities & Engineering Support Services (RF&ESS) Contracting Officer Technical Representative; and Louann Beu, DFRC RF&ESS Contracting Officer nominated Arcata for the award. Currently, Arcata provides engineering, operations and maintenance, information technology multimedia services to NASA's Dryden Flight Research Center as the Research Facilities and Engineering Support Services (RF&ESS) contractor. Arcata was selected among all nominees in SBA Region IX which covers Nevada, California, Arizona and Hawaii.

Prime Contractor of the Year nominations are judged on the following criteria: overall management, technical capabilities, cost performance, resource utilization, financial strength, delivery performance, labor relations, special achievements, customer interface and exceptional results. Regional winners are eligible for the national award, the US SBA Prime Contractor of the Year Award. This Award will be announced during National Small Business Week (April 12-13) in Washington D.C.
